He Needs to Get the Irish to Play with Attitude

Here’s Notre Dame’s biggest issue under Brian Kelly. They tend to play down to lesser Power 5 opponents and go into games against elite teams expecting to lose. There were sparks of that attitude changing this season, as at halftime of the USF game, he said that he was tired of being the nice guy and wanted a blowout.

He said that they didn’t have enough of a chip on their shoulder in the ACC Championship Game, and that’s what cost them. He said they’d have it back for the Rose Bowl. Maybe so, but they still lost by three scores.

Kelly needs to reignite a wave of anger in this team. They need to want to destroy opponents and prove they belong. As long as there are stinker games, like Michigan in 2019 or Miami in 2017, this team will always be seen as less than the other top tier of teams.

If the Irish start playing with an attitude, intimidating their opponents and growing in confidence, they’ll be back in a New Year’s Six games next season. Without it, however, it could be a long rebuild for Notre Dame, as there is a lot of roster turnover to deal with.
